Houses are seen in the old city of Sanaa May 30, 2013. Local authorities have announced that they will launch an extensive campaign next week to restore buildings and remove any changes made to their facade, the latter which had provoked the United Nations Educational, Scientific and Cultural Organisation (UNESCO) to threaten to remove the city from its world heritage list.
